Course Content

• Understanding the Dynamics of Dialogue: Exploring the interplay between communication styles, active listening, and conflict resolution.
• Action Planning & Goal Setting: Developing effective strategies and establishing measurable objectives for balanced action.
• Balancing Dialogue and Action in Decision-Making: Integrating collaborative discussion with decisive action for optimal outcomes.
• Effective Communication Techniques for Balanced Dialogue: Mastering non-violent communication, assertiveness, and feedback mechanisms.
• Identifying and Addressing Barriers to Balanced Dialogue: Recognizing and overcoming obstacles such as power imbalances, biases, and emotional reactivity.
• Building Collaborative Relationships for Enhanced Action: Fostering trust, respect, and mutual understanding to support collaborative efforts.
• Conflict Resolution & Negotiation Skills: Implementing practical strategies to resolve disagreements and achieve mutually beneficial solutions.
• Strategic Action Planning & Implementation: Developing and executing well-defined action plans, monitoring progress, and adapting as needed.
• Measuring the Impact of Balanced Dialogue & Action: Evaluating effectiveness and identifying areas for improvement in achieving program goals.
